DINING:

there is no way on earth anyone could eat all that (has anyone tried?) There is WAYYY too much food, and we didn't get to try half the snacks we wanted to! Bummer for us!

Pricing: It cost my family (2 adults, 3 kids) $110 per day on the DDP, and almost every TS meal was $100 just for that ONE meal! So I don't know how you could go and NOT save money IF you have at least on TS a day ... we left with an entire day of counter service credits (FIVE!) but still came out way ahead.

KIDS FOOD NOTE: My kids were not happy with the choices: nuggets, mac n' cheese, and pizza at most places. And most of hte time they didn't like the type of mac 'n cheese. They DID like the Uncrustables at many places (esp. bakery shops), the applesauce, and grapes...

Here are my TS reviews:

GARDEN GRILL(EP) -- characters came around 3 times! best dinner w/ characters (food quality and atmosphere... I loved being served rather than getting up), quieter restaurant, nice ambiance!

50'S PRIME TIME (DHS) -- food was SO YUMMY!!! Fried chicken totally ROCKS and dad's brownie sundae was GREAT!

LIBERTY TREE (MK) -- good, tastes like Thanksgiving dinner, and not as greasy as other food! Esp. love the mashed potatoes and apple dessert!

TUSKER HOUSE BUFFET (AK) -- magical start to the day! Character interaction and dancing is worth it!

CRYSTAL PALACE (MK) -- least fav., but Pooh characters are cute. The food ranged from yuck to good depending on the dish. The kids hated the cardboard pizza...

CORAL REEF (EP) -- OH MY GOSH - this is a league of it's own!! I got the blakened catfish, DH got the Mahi Mahi. Is this really on the dining plan? Also loved the butterscotch creme brulee and the chocolate wave!

CAPE MAY BF BUFFET (Beach Club) -- the characters were slow, and we had less time with them, but the food was absolutely amazing, even better than Tusker house! Beautiful upscale place, we will certainly go back!

NOTES ON CS: I looked over the CS and menus before we left, then planned to "wing-it" in the parks. Somewhat of a mistake... we couldn't remember where the best kids' food was, and if there was anything we wanted to try (except in Epcot)... so, you may need to note if there is a particular CS place you want to go to.

CS Reviews: not many worth mentioning except:

Earl of Sandwhich (DTD): YOU HAVE to try this!!! Yummm! Our lunch (for 2 of us) would've cost $20 without the plan, so we saved money that day! Totally delicious!

FISH IN CHIPS STAND (Epcot): sooooo good!! Small portion, but that's OK. It's worth it!

Lotus Blossum (Epcot): we liked the orange chicken, but the same as you can expect from your local Chinese place.

Mainstreet Bakery (MK): my tomato and mozarella sandwhich was so fresh and yummy! DH's sandwich was only OK. Desserts were fabulous!

Glad you had a good dining trip. :thumbsup2

I usually caution people that having a strict plan for CS: we are eating at this one place, can be a mistake because while in the park so many things can happen such that you are nowhere near that CS location when hunger strikes. Sounds like your wing it plan kind of yielded the same result. What did work for us was having at least 3 options at any park that could work for us. That is how we ended up at MSB one night after Spectro. We are vegetarians so I really needed to know where we could eat. On the character buffets, the kids easily pay for their plan for the day (and you haven't used CS yet!)...if you were just 2 adults and say ate at Sci-Fi Diner for lunch and each just ordered a burger and a coke each...that would only be $31 + tax then add $20 counter service (assuming you skip desert) and $6 snacks =$58.86 vs. $79.98/day of the dining plan...My family, for instance is 4 adults and a 2 year old...we are probably just breaking even if you count that we really wouldn't eat that many snacks and desserts...so those are a bonus, but the plan isn't saving us money that we would have spent anyhow...except the holiday surcharge does change that since we want a lot of buffets!

I do like the convenience of pre-paid though. I am so excited for our trip!:woohoo:
